A Real-World Test: Embroidering It on a Linen-Cotton Kitchen Towel

Last week, I stitched I May Be Wrong Sarcastic Design, Mom SVG onto a medium-weight linen-cotton blend tea towel for a small-batch boutique order. Why this fabric? Because it’s common in handmade home goods—and unforgiving. Linen shifts, breathes, and shows every stitch imperfection. I used a light cutaway stabilizer, 40-weight poly thread in charcoal gray, and ran it at standard density. The result? Crisp edges, no puckering, and the sarcasm landed *exactly* as intended—playful, not snarky. Customers who saw the finished piece laughed, then asked where to buy more. That’s the sweet spot: personalized gift appeal meets quiet craftsmanship.

Where It Shines (and Where It Needs Caution)

This design works beautifully for:

But proceed thoughtfully with:

  1. Small hoop sizes: Below 3", letter spacing tightens and inner curves can lose definition—test before committing to a cap or infant hat.
  2. Stretchy fabric: On knits like jersey tees, skip direct stitching unless you add tear-away + cutaway combo stabilizer and reduce stitch density slightly.
  3. Dark fabric: The design doesn’t include an automatic underlay—so if you’re stitching on black or navy, manually add a light underlay layer or choose high-contrast thread (e.g., bright white or cream) to maintain readability.
  4. Curved surfaces: Caps and beanies require re-digitizing or manual adjustment—the original file assumes flat embroidery. Don’t assume it will auto-fit.
